Money & Mobile Phones for K-12

HP is back with another Technology for Teaching Grant supporting the innovative use of mobile technology in K-12 public schools and two- and four-year colleges and universities.

Q.   Not sure what innovative mobile technology looks like?
A.   Ask your colleagues at Teacher Talk.

Deadline: February 15, 2006.

Young Success

  • Ephren Taylor II
    Ephren W. Taylor (Overland Park, KS) founded his first company at the age of 12, became a millionaire at 16, and was the CEO of a multimillion-dollar corporation by the age of 23. Today, he is one of the youngest CEO's to ever run a publicly traded company. He leads City Capital Corp. which manages diversified investments.
